Chicken With Spinach And Mushrooms In Creamy Parmesan Sauce (Print version)

Juicy skillet chicken with mushrooms, spinach, garlic, and a creamy Parmesan sauce that is rich but still fresh.

# Ingredients:

For the chicken

01 - 2 large boneless skinless chicken breasts, about 1 1/2 lb (680 g), sliced into 4 thin cutlets
02 - 1 teaspoon kosher salt, divided
03 - 1/2 teaspoon black pepper, divided
04 - 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
05 - 2 tablespoons olive oil

For the creamy Parmesan sauce

06 - 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
07 - 8 oz (225 g) cremini mushrooms, sliced
08 - 4 cloves garlic, minced
09 - 4 cups (120 g) fresh baby spinach
10 - 3/4 cup (180 ml) low-sodium chicken broth
11 - 1 cup (240 ml) heavy cream
12 - 3/4 cup (75 g) freshly grated Parmesan cheese
13 - 1 teaspoon fresh lemon juice, plus more to taste
14 - 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ley, for serving

# Instructions:

01 - Slice the chicken breasts horizontally into 4 thin cutlets. Season both sides with about 3/4 teaspoon salt, 1/4 teaspoon pepper, and the Italian seasoning.
02 -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the chicken and cook for 3-4 minutes per side until golden. Transfer to a plate. It will finish cooking in the sauce.
03 - Reduce the heat to medium. Add the butter and mushrooms to the same skillet. Cook for 6-8 minutes, stirring only now and then, until the mushrooms are browned and their moisture has cooked off.
04 - Add the garlic and cook for 30 seconds. Stir in the spinach and cook for 1-2 minutes until just wilted.
05 - Pour in the chicken broth and scrape up the browned bits from the pan. Add the heavy cream and bring to a gentle simmer. Stir in the Parmesan until melted and smooth.
06 - Return the chicken and any juices to the skillet. Simmer gently for 4-6 minutes, until the chicken reaches 165°F. Stir in lemon juice, adjust salt and pepper, and finish with parsley.

# Good to know:

01 - Serve immediately while the Parmesan sauce is glossy.
02 - Add a splash of broth if the sauce thickens too much before serving.
03 - Leftovers keep well in the fridge for up to 3 days.
